Bio
Carlie Wall
Singer, Songwriter and guitarist
When Carlie Wall first picked up a guitar, she knew music would become her voice. By 13, she had already written and released her debut album, launching a career rooted in raw talent, heartfelt storytelling, and an unmistakable voice. Every song on every album she’s released has been written solely by her, showcasing her deeply personal and authentic approach to music.
Carlie’s songwriting has earned her multiple first-place awards, including a prestigious win representing Utah in the Colgate Country Showdown, which led her to the regional finals in Coos Bay, Oregon. Her voice has also made a lasting impact in commercial work—most notably as the featured singer for the 15-year-running Dixie Direct radio ad in St. George, Utah.
Throughout her career, Carlie has collaborated with a range of talented artists, including a powerful operatic duet of The Prayer with Nathan Osmond at Tuacahn Amphitheatre. She’s recorded at the iconic 17th Street Studios in Santa Monica, California—home to legendary acts like Sublime and Sugar Ray—and has graced the pages of numerous magazines and newspapers. Carlie has also shared the stage with national acts, performing alongside Secondhand Serenade and Camera Can’t Lie at the Electric Theater in St. George, Utah.
She has headlined shows across the western U.S., from the beaches of Hawaii to the deserts of Arizona, the lights of Las Vegas, the stages of Utah, and the coastlines of Oregon. Between the ages of 13 and 17, she toured extensively with her full band and is now, at 29, making a bold and passionate return to the stage.
Her newest single, Ocean, written by Carlie Wall, is the first glimpse into this next chapter.
